summ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John Christopher Anderson <jchris@apache.org>2009-01-07 18:33:51 +0000
committerJohn Christopher Anderson <jchris@apache.org>2009-01-07 18:33:51 +0000
commitef1e6a1c98ff0c2e2bb2789495c9d272f14078b8 (patch)
tree3cc5ef3d95316e0bffdc590a5b63a2da2239f9c2
parentaa48faa19166a1f31d3f2ba6a7c28cc7535b7c6d (diff)
friendly error message on use of count instead of limit
git-svn-id: https://svn.apache.org/repos/asf/couchdb/trunk@732420 13f79535-47bb-0310-9956-ffa450edef68
-rw-r--r--src/couchdb/couch_httpd_view.erl2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/couchdb/couch_httpd_view.erl b/src/couchdb/couch_httpd_view.erl
index 79f275c9..de184de9 100644
--- a/src/couchdb/couch_httpd_view.erl
+++ b/src/couchdb/couch_httpd_view.erl
@@ -254,6 +254,8 @@ parse_view_query(Req, Keys, IsReduce) ->
Msg = io_lib:format("Bad URL query value, number expected: limit=~s", [Value]),
throw({query_parse_error, Msg})
end;
+ {"count", Value} ->
+ throw({query_parse_error, "URL query parameter 'count' has been changed to 'limit'."});
{"update", "false"} ->
Args#view_query_args{update=false};
{"descending", "true"} ->